SN74AS374DW belongs to the category of integrated circuits (ICs).
This IC is commonly used in digital electronics for storing and manipulating data. It serves as a flip-flop or latch, allowing the storage of binary information.
SN74AS374DW is available in a 20-pin SOIC (Small Outline Integrated Circuit) package.
The essence of SN74AS374DW lies in its ability to store and retain digital information, making it an essential component in many electronic devices.
SN74AS374DW is typically packaged in reels or tubes, containing a specific quantity of ICs per package. The exact quantity may vary depending on the manufacturer's specifications.
SN74AS374DW operates based on the principles of flip-flops or latches. It stores binary information by capturing and retaining the input data at the rising edge of the clock pulse. The stored data remains unchanged until a new input is received and captured.

Some alternative models that offer similar functionality to SN74AS374DW include: - SN74LS374: Low-power Schottky version - SN74HC374: High-speed CMOS version - SN74HCT374: High-speed CMOS with TTL compatibility
These alternative models can be considered based on specific application requirements, power consumption constraints, or compatibility needs.
